Publication number: 20260130454Abstract: A helmet including a helmet shell for receiving a head of a wearer, the helmet shell defining therein an anchor chamber and an anchor aperture opening into the anchor chamber configured to selectively permit passage of the anchor lock therethrough. A first dimension of the anchor aperture extends along a left-right axis of the helmet shell, a second dimension of the anchor aperture extending along a forward-rearward axis, the second dimension being orthogonal to and greater than the first dimension. A first dimension of the anchor chamber extending along a left-right axis of the helmet shell, the first dimension of the anchor chamber being greater than the first dimension of the anchor aperture, such that when the anchor lock is received in the anchor chamber and rotated orthogonal to the first dimension of the anchor aperture, the anchor lock cannot pass through the anchor aperture.Type: ApplicationFiled: January 7, 2026Publication date: May 14, 2026Inventor: Michael ROY

Publication number: 20250297878Abstract: A waste container monitoring system may include a monitoring device configured to be positioned in a waste container, a remote processing system, and sensors to monitor conditions of the container. A communication connection communicates the one or more conditions to the remote processing system. A waste compactor monitoring system may include a monitoring assembly having a hub device and one or more sensors connected to the hub device and distributed around the waste compactor system, the one or more sensors being configured to monitor one or more conditions of the waste compactor system. A sensor assembly for a waste container monitoring system may connect to a hydraulic reservoir in a waste compactor. The sensor assembly may include a breather cap, a sensing element for detecting a level and/or a temperature of fluid in the hydraulic reservoir, and a dip tube to support the sensing element inside the hydraulic reservoir.Type: ApplicationFiled: June 5, 2025Publication date: September 25, 2025Inventors: Michael Hess, Michael Roy

Publication number: 20240298735Abstract: A helmet has: a helmet shell; a battery connected to the helmet shell; an electric connector connected to the helmet shell; and at least one electric device electrically connected to the battery and to the electric connector. In response to the electric connector being electrically connected to an external power source and receiving electric power for the external power source, electric power is supplied to the at least one electric device from the electric connector. In response to the electric connector not receiving electric power from the external power source, electric power is supplied to the at least one electric device from the battery.Type: ApplicationFiled: February 16, 2024Publication date: September 12, 2024Inventors: Frederic GAMACHE CAMIRE, Philippe LAGOURGUE, Kevin YERGEAU, Michael ROY
